How Wordle works

Wordle, by Josh Wardle, launched publicly in October 2021. The New York Times Company bought it in January 2022 for a “low seven-figure sum.” Players get six tries at one shared five-letter word each day.

  1. Type a valid five-letter word and press Enter.
  2. Green means correct letter and place; yellow means the letter is in the word; grey means it is not.
  3. You have six tries. Everyone in a timezone gets the same daily word. Play on NYT Games — this page cannot embed it.
